Understanding the Color Burgundy

Burgundy is a captivating color that sits comfortably between red and purple. Its rich, velvety tone evokes feelings of warmth and sophistication. Named after the wine produced in the Burgundy region of France, this shade carries an air of elegance.

The depth of burgundy can vary significantly, from dark shades resembling deep wine to lighter tones that hint at mauve. This versatility makes it appealing for various applications, whether in fashion or interior design.

Psychologically, burgundy represents ambition and power but also comfort. It’s a hue that invites conversation while maintaining an aura of refinement.

Tips for Combining Burgundy with Neutrals

Burgundigjolu pairs beautifully with various neutral shades. The rich depth of burgundy contrasts elegantly against soft grays and creamy whites, creating a sophisticated balance.

When using neutrals like beige or taupe, consider the texture. A plush velvet burgundy cushion alongside a linen sofa can elevate your space dramatically. Layering textures adds dimension without overwhelming the eye.

For a modern touch, incorporate black accents. Think sleek furniture or frames that ground the boldness of burgundigjolu while allowing it to shine as an accent color.

Don’t forget about metallics! Gold or brass elements can warm up neutral palettes and complement the warmth found in burgundy tones.

Experiment with placement. Use larger neutral pieces as anchors and let smaller splashes of burgundigjolu do the talking through accessories like throws or artwork.

Mistakes to Avoid When Mixing Burgundy and Other Colors

Mixing burgundigjolu can be a delightful challenge, but there are common pitfalls to watch out for. One major mistake is overlooking the undertones of your colors. Burgundy has warm tones, so pairing it with cool colors without consideration can lead to discord.

Another frequent error is using too many bold shades at once. While vibrant combinations can create drama, they might also overwhelm the space or outfit. Choose one or two standout hues and let burgundy take center stage.

Don’t ignore balance in your designs. If you have a dominant burgundy piece, make sure other colors are supportive rather than competing for attention.

Avoid neglecting texture when mixing colors. Different textures can influence how color interacts with light and each other, adding depth to your palette—something worth considering as you experiment!
